Trump Receives Grand Welcome in Beijing with Fusion Menu and YMCA Anthem
Former US President Donald Trump received a lavish welcome during his visit to Beijing, characterized by a blend of diplomatic pomp and cultural eccentricity. The state banquet, held in the prestigious Great Hall of the People, featured a unique menu combining traditional Chinese Peking duck with Western beef and Italian grappa, symbolizing a fusion of Eastern and Western flavors. The event was marked by unusual entertainment choices, including the playing of the Village People's hit song 'YMCA' alongside the American national anthem, creating a distinctive atmosphere for the visiting dignitary.
